2.       Please remember that your child cannot be at school if they have 2 or more of the following symptoms: fever/feverish, sore throat, headache, runny nose, a new cough or worsening chronic cough, new onset of fatigue or muscle ache, diarrhea, loss of taste or smell; in children, purple markings on the fingers or toes.


 

      Students who have 2 or more symptoms cannot come to school. Students who get sick with two or more symptoms while at school, will be sent home. If your child does have two or more symptoms, we suggest you call 811 to discuss.
